[rubygems/rubygems] Fix error when Bundler installation is corrupted

If one upgrades the default copy of Bundler through `gem update
--system`, and then reinstalls Ruby without removing the previous copy.
Then the new installation will have a correct default bundler gemspec,
but a higher copy installed in site_dir.

This causes a crash when running Bundler and prints the bug report
template.

This could probably be fixed in Ruby install script, by removing any
previous Bundler default copies, but if the problem is already there, I
think it's best to print a proper user error.

class CorruptBundlerInstallError < BundlerError
def initialize(loaded_spec)
@loaded_spec = loaded_spec
end
def message
"The running version of Bundler (#{Bundler::VERSION}) does not match the version of the specification installed for it (#{@loaded_spec.version}). " \
"This can be caused by reinstalling Ruby without removing previous installation, leaving around an upgraded default version of Bundler. " \
"Reinstalling Ruby from scratch should fix the problem."
end
status_code(39)
end
end
